I was just answering your question " But what if I can't open the old photoshop since it is resident on an external drive now", didn't know you couldn't find them. If you didn't save them as an .ATN using the actions menu, then you can find them here:


C:\Documents and Settings\Username\Application Data\Adobe\Photoshop\8.0\Adobe Photoshop CS Settings\Actions Palette.psp


Username = username you use to log in.


I would advice copying the file back to the original CS location, because I can't guarantee it will work when you copy it to the CS2 location:


C:\Documents and Settings\Username\Application Data\Adobe\Photoshop\9.0\Adobe Photoshop CS2 Settings\Actions Palette.psp
